Ross County's Vigurs laughs off Tottenham rumours

Ross County midfielder Iain Vigurs has made it fervently clear that a recent link to Tottenham was merely speculation.

The 24-year old has been in fine form in the Scottish Premier League this season after helping the Staggies gain promotion to the top flight last term, so much so that a rumour regarding a winter move to Spurs was circling.

But Vigurs has insisted that was never the case and suggests he is simply content playing football for County.

"Everything that was said during the transfer window was just rumour and speculation," he told SunSport.

"I was just chilling on the couch waiting to see what happened with other transfers.

"I'm just happy to play football here. I'm not really bothered with anything else at the moment, to be honest.

"There were all sort of stories flying around, obviously.

"My brother said someone had me at White Hart Lane. I was like 'What? Was I delivering something?' It is funny.

"It is crazy what rumours go about. It is always good to be talked about but until something is in front of you and done and dusted, you can't really say anything.

"I haven't been offered anything yet by the club, but they said they do want me which is always a bonus. I wouldn't move just for the sake of it. If I am going to move, it will have to be the right one because Ross County is a great club."
